We use fully adhered EPDM systems when you want maximum wind resistance and the strongest possible bond between membrane and deck. In this installation method, we apply adhesive across the entire roof surface, then secure the rubber membrane directly to the substrate.
This approach works especially well on buildings in areas prone to high winds, eliminating potential leak points at fastener locations. Allen Commercial Roofing ensures every inch of adhesive is applied correctly so your roof performs as designed.
Mechanically attached systems use fasteners and plates to secure the EPDM membrane to the roof deck, making installation faster than fully adhered options. Our crews drive fasteners around the perimeter and at regular intervals across the field, creating a strong hold that resists wind uplift.
This method works well when roof access is limited or when you need the roof installed quickly without waiting for adhesive to cure. We mechanically attach EPDM on warehouses, industrial buildings, and facilities where the roof sees regular equipment use.
Ballasted systems use concrete pavers or stones to hold the EPDM membrane in place without adhesive or fasteners anchoring it to the deck. We spread the rubber membrane loosely over the roof, then position ballast materials strategically to ensure proper drainage and prevent membrane slippage.
Doing this system is great for buildings where you might need roof access later or want to avoid drilling into the deck. Allen Commercial Roofing chooses ballasted systems on retail centers and multi-tenant properties because they're easy to maintain and repair.
Before we cut a single piece of membrane, we inspect your existing roof surface and plan the entire project carefully. We identify any structural damage, soft spots, or issues that need repair before the new membrane goes down.
Our team measures the roof precisely, calculates material quantities, and creates a detailed timeline so we know exactly how long the work will take. Allen Commercial Roofing coordinates with your operations to schedule work around your busiest times whenever possible.
We can't install a strong EPDM system on a weak surface, so we prepare the roof deck thoroughly before laying membrane. This means cleaning away debris, repairing damaged areas, and creating a smooth, secure base for the new material.
Once the surface is ready, we unroll the EPDM membrane across the roof and position it carefully for optimal coverage. Our crew uses the attachment method you've chosen and ensures every section is properly secured to the deck.
Where two pieces of EPDM meet, we create watertight seams using specialized welding techniques and roofing cement. Our crew welds each seam to manufacturer spec and tests for strength and water-tightness with no shortcuts.
After the entire membrane is installed, we perform a detailed final inspection, walking the entire roof surface and checking every detail. Allen Commercial Roofing documents the final inspection in writing so you have proof of quality workmanship.

Yes, epdm roofing is a good choice for Texas weather because it handles heat, UV exposure, heavy rain, and temperature changes well. The rubber membrane stays flexible through changing conditions and helps protect the roof from cracking. Our company installs quality EPDM systems designed for long-term performance.
Yes, EPDM roofing can sometimes be installed over an existing roof if the current roof is in suitable condition. We first inspect the roof deck and existing materials to determine whether an overlay is appropriate. If needed, we recommend a complete roof replacement for better long-term performance.
EPDM roofing often includes roof insulation when better energy efficiency or building code compliance is needed. The right insulation also helps improve indoor comfort and supports the roofing system. We recommend the appropriate insulation based on your property's requirements.
EPDM roofing needs routine inspections, debris removal, and prompt repair of any damaged areas. Keeping drains clear and checking seams regularly helps maintain roof performance. Our company offers maintenance services to help keep your EPDM roof in good condition.
